随着高校教育管理信息化的发展,离校管理系统成为提高工作效率的重要工具。该系统旨在简化学生离校流程,提供自动化管理功能,从而提升学校管理效率。
系统概述
离校管理系统主要包括用户模块、申请模块、审核模块、通知模块等。系统通过Web界面为用户提供服务,用户可以在线提交离校申请,并查看审批状态。
数据库设计
数据库设计是系统的核心部分。以下是一个简化的数据库表结构示例:
CREATE TABLE student (
id INT PRIMARY KEY AUTO_INCREMENT,
name VARCHAR(50),
student_id VARCHAR(20),
department VARCHAR(50)
);
CREATE TABLE departure_application (
id INT PRIMARY KEY AUTO_INCREMENT,
student_id VARCHAR(20),
reason TEXT,
status ENUM('Pending', 'Approved', 'Rejected'),
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P
);
关键代码示例
以下是处理离校申请的一个简单示例代码,使用PHP语言实现:
function applyForDeparture($studentId, $reason) {
$conn = new mysqli("localhost", "username", "password", "database");
if ($conn->connect_error) {
die("Connection failed: " . $conn->connect_error);
}
$sql = "INSERT INTO departure_application (student_id, reason) VALUES (?, ?)";
$stmt = $conn->prepare($sql);
$stmt->bind_param("ss", $studentId, $reason);
if ($stmt->execute()) {
return true;
} else {
return false;
}
}
?>
软件著作权证书
在完成系统开发后,为了保护知识产权,应向国家版权局申请软件著作权证书。申请时需要提交完整的软件源代码、设计文档等相关材料。